                    Filling in Forms







        Filling in forms is something we all have to do for all sorts of
        reasons. Some are straightforward. Others  are more com-
        plicated. For whatever reason we have to fill in a form, it is
        important that it is legible and that all the information that is
        required is clearly set out. If it is difficult to type in  the
        information, it is a good idea to print it so that the recipient
        can read it easily.




        WORKING ONLINE
        Today, much form filling can be done online although the
        forms will follow a similar pattern to the ‘paper’ ones.




        PROVIDING THE BASIC INFORMATION

        Doing market research
        Market researchers who send out forms to a sample of
        people usually require you either to tick boxes or to answer
        specific questions. The only personal details they might
        require are your age bracket, your sex, your type of living
        accommodation, whether you are employed and your salary
        bracket. These are the easiest forms to fill in although they
        often look daunting at first because they sometimes consist
        of several pages. (See example in Figure 6.)
